Kenyan citizens have an opportunity to own affordable homes, thanks to President William Ruto’s housing initiative.
The program which seeks to build 250,000 units annually has the unit's proices ranging from Sh840,000 to Sh5.76 million.
The housing projects are classified into social, affordable, and market units.
Social housing includes one to three-room homes for slum dwellers.
Affordable units consist of studios and two to three-bedroom apartments.
Market-driven developments offer two to three-bedroom houses.
